    The Science Behind IV Drip Therapy

    IV drip therapy may seem like a new wellness trend, but it’s an old medical staple. During an IV drip infusion, a needle attached to a catheter tube is inserted into a blood vein, usually in the arm or hand. Then, a bag filled with fluids or nutrients is connected to the catheter. Hydration Hydration drips deliver fluids directly into the bloodstream, bypassing the digestive system. They help to hydrate the body quickly, as well as provide a boost of vitamins and antioxidants.
